Can I pay the application fee with a check instead of using a credit card?

If you cannot pay the application fee using a credit card you may send us a personal or bank check in US Funds drawn on a US bank, US Postal Money Orders or Travelers Checks. No other form of payment will be accepted.

If you are an international student, applying from outside the United States and you wish to pay the application fee by check rather than a credit card, payment of the application fee must be remitted as outlined above, but with the following conditions: pre-printed on the check must be: a) the US address, and b) the nine-digit ABA or routing number at the bottom.

To whom should my application fee check be made payable?

All checks should be made payable to Columbia University.
